Since its launch in February 2022, Valve’s Steam Deck has made significant strides in the realm of portable gaming, solidifying its place as a fan favorite among PC gamers. Despite some initial challenges, the device has paved the way for a new generation of handheld PCs. While a few competitors are emerging in the market, the Steam Deck stands out as the primary choice for gamers eager to access their extensive libraries while on the go. Although compatibility is not universal across all titles, the top games for the Steam Deck include some of the most remarkable projects released in recent years.

Valve continues to offer multiple models of the Steam Deck, with three primary options: the 256GB LCD, 512GB OLED, and 1TB OLED. The 64GB and 512GB LCD models are also still available but are subject to stock availability. Recently, Valve has introduced refurbished units, although they often sell out quickly. Once players acquire their device, they can check out the best Steam Deck Verified games, which are updated monthly to reflect new additions.

Purchases can be conveniently made through Valve’s official store. Always ensure to verify a game’s compatibility on the Steam platform; Protondb is another excellent tool for assessing performance on the Steam Deck.

1. Left 4 Dead 2

Steam User Rating: 97%

Left 4 Dead 2

Left 4 Dead 2 represents an archetype for the Verified games on Deck, embodying the timeless appeal that keeps it at the forefront of players’ minds. Often considered Valve’s most replayable game, it seamlessly brings friends together for thrilling zombie-slaying sessions. Numerous titles have tried to replicate its success, but few can match the excellence refined in Valve’s second iteration of this beloved series.

3. Baldur’s Gate 3

Steam User Rating: 96%

Baldur's Gate 3

Baldur’s Gate 3 made waves in the gaming community when it peaked at over 800,000 simultaneous players on Steam. This remarkable success can be attributed to developer Larian Studios’ expertise in crafting RPGs, specifically in the tactical genre. As one of the most celebrated franchises in the industry, Baldur’s Gate sets an unattainable benchmarking for RPGs to follow.

With a storytelling that balances humor and drama, its character creator enhances gameplay in a profound way. The strategic party-based combat can be unrelenting, making it imperative for players to think critically as they engage in tactical battles, catering both to seasoned players and those new to the genre.

4. Hades

Steam User Rating: 98%

Hades

Hades, while not the first in the roguelike genre, stands as one of the most influential and successful titles, thanks to its compelling combat and narrative integration. Newcomers and veterans alike should find an engaging experience in Supergiant’s 2020 hit, which has recently expanded with the introduction of Hades 2, also verified for the Steam Deck and currently in early access.

7. The Planet Crafter

Steam User Rating: 96%

The Planet Crafter

After its free prologue in 2021, The Planet Crafter finally launched in April 2024, receiving positive acclaim for its survival and terraforming mechanics. Players are dropped into a barren world, tasked with transforming it into a habitable haven, experiencing a rewarding sense of progress as they reshape the environment.
